Claiming
In order to claim the warranty service, you must return the
Personal Communicator and/or accessories in question to
Motorola's Authorised Repair or Service Centre in the original
configuration and packaging as supplied by Motorola. Please
avoid leaving any supplementary items like SIM cards. The
Product should also be accompanied by a label with your name,
address, and telephone number; name of operator and a
description of the problem. In the case of vehicular installation,
the vehicle in which the Personal Communicator is installed
should be driven to the Authorised Repair or Service Centre, as
analysis of any problem may require inspection of the entire
vehicular installation.
In order to be eligible to receive warranty service, you must
present your receipt of purchase or a comparable substitute proof
of purchase bearing the date of purchase. The phone should also
clearly display the original compatible electronic serial number
(IMEI) and mechanic serial number [MSN]. Such information is
contained with the Product.
